2. Different types of detergent
Detergents – Refers to a product used to remove adhering soils from a solid medium by suspending or dissolving them. It is an alkaline- or acid-reacting chemical compound with wetting power used in cleaning.
Acid detergents have the property of being able to wash containers that have contained CO 2 without the need to remove this gas before washing. An acid detergent will be suitable for removing mineral soiling, while an alkaline detergent will perform well against organic soiling.
